 > On aarch64 With the config option "--enable-mpers=check" the configure.ac
 > script searchs for a 32bit compiler. When a matching compiler is found
 > in the PATH some compatiblity checks are done. This can fail when the
 > available kernel headers on host and buildroot target does not match.

 > Since buildroot does not support 32bit binaries when building for 64bit
 > architecture (no -m32 option) we can disable this option unconditionally.

 > When disabling unconditionally also the configuration for toolchain using
 > MUSL can be removed.
